On Sat, 12 Dec 2009 01:10:39 Christoph Lameter wrote:
> Could you make the scheduler build time configurable instead of replacing
> the existing one? Embedded folks in particular may love a low footprint
> scheduler.
> 

It's not a bad idea, but the kernel still needs to be patched either way. To 
get BFS they'd need to patch the kernel. If they didn't want BFS, they 
wouldn't patch it in the first place.
